2. Physiognomy was an early method of attempting to distinguish criminals and deviants based on their physical characteristics. In this case, facial features were used. Which of the following was NOT presumed to be a feature that deviants possessed?
a) Large nose
b) All of these were considered "deviant" characteristics
c) Weak chin
d) Shifty eyes
The correct answer is b) All of these were considered "deviant" characteristics
3. Next came the use of phrenology, which involved feeling a part of a person's body to find bumps that would determine if they were deviant or not; what part of the body was felt?
a) feet
b) head
c) stomach
d) back
The correct answer is b) head
4. Craniometry involved measuring around people's skulls and using that measurement to determine their tendency towards deviance. An individual was thought to be deviant if he or she had what kind of brain measurement?
a) Either larger or smaller than average
b) Smaller than average
c) Larger than average
d) Average
The correct answer is a) Either larger or smaller than average
5. Cesare Lombroso was one of the most famous believers of biologically determined criminality. Which of these "schools" was he the founder of?
a) Postmodernist School
b) Chicago School
c) Italian School
d) Neo-Classical School
The correct answer is c) Italian School
6. Which of these is a Lombrosian term for the phenomenon of a person being an "evolutionary throwback"?
a) atavism
b) maladaptation
c) vestigiality
d) spandrel
The correct answer is a) Atavism
